Hill wins third task order on $900m medical campus in Minnesota

New York-listed construction consultant Hill International has been awarded a third task order to provide owner’s representative services for the $900m "Vision Northland" medical campus being developed by Essentia Health in downtown Duluth, Minnesota.

Vision Northland involves building a replacement hospital for St. Mary’s Medical Center and new clinical space, as well as renovating existing clinics. Construction is due to complete in the first quarter of 2023 and open for patient care by the third quarter of 2023.

As the Owner’s Representative, Hill is leading planning, design, and construction of the campus, and preparing for clinical activation with oversight of procurement of medical equipment, commissioning, and activation planning.

In total, the project will deliver approximately 942,000 sq ft of new facilities and a substantial amount of renovated facilities for patients across northern Minnesota, Wisconsin and beyond.

Hill has been supporting the programme since 2019, when it was brought in to identify areas of greatest cost impact. Since then, Essentia has retained Hill to provide owner’s representative and project management services throughout construction.

Hill Senior Vice President and Regional Manager Vic Spinabelli said of the award: "[Program Director] Steve Catts and his team have done an outstanding job adding value to the Vision Northland program, which I think this new award demonstrates. We view our role as being good stewards for Essentia and appreciate the trust they have placed in Hill to help deliver this project as efficiently and cost-effectively as possible."
